A male United Kingdom age 41-50, *ugostephen writes:

I split with my girlfriend 2 months ago, we are expecting our first child, she did not want to stay together for the sake of the baby as she no loger loves me.

I feel very lonley very isolated, every night i dream of my ex and i wake up upset because they feel very real. I cant imagine having to start over with another girl let myself get close to somone else.

She is coping ver well with this, she seams very happy and content in what she is doing. I got on with her family so well and went out wth then every weekend i so miss this friendship and connection i had with her parents, i cant go to the places i loved with them anymore, the pain hurts so much.

I am worried about the future because i feel i dont have one and when she gets a new boyfriend could i cope

A male reader, Collaroy Australia +, writes (30 May 2008):

Collaroy agony auntHi mate,

I'm really sorry to see you going through this it must be painful.

After two months if you are still feeling like this I think you should get some counselling. While it would be expected to still be hurt after this period of time you sound quite distressed. You could end up damaging you health so get someone to talk to ( a professional )before your life ends up in the crapper - sorry to be blunt but you have got to try and .

Your ex wife has moved on with her life for her own reasons and I'm sure she is not having as easy a time as you might think she is. As hard as that is to handle you are going to find a way sometime in the future to accept it. She will move on with her life and you will too.

But you have one miracle coming out of this relationship , your child, and that is what you should focus on in the future.

Its not going to be easy, but you will pull through buddy.

All the best.
